Fluid Antenna System (FAS)

Position-Flexible Dynamically Movable Pixel Antenna Array

Antenna technology where the physical radiating element can dynamically move or shift position on a microscopic scale to find fading peaks.

Technical Explanation

In wireless channels, signal strength fluctuates over millimeters due to constructive and destructive interference (deep fading). Traditional antennas are fixed in position and get stuck in signal nulls. A Fluid Antenna System (FAS) uses liquid metal (such as gallium-indium alloys) or reconfigurable micro-pixel RF switches. Within fractions of a millisecond, the radiating position shifts to an adjacent spatial point where constructive interference peaks, delivering a 10-20 dB signal boost without increasing transmit power.

Key Functions

  • Shifts antenna radiation location physically or electronically across micro-distances
  • Escapes destructive multipath fading nulls instantaneously without antenna diversity
  • Delivers 10-20 dB SNR improvements in complex, dense multipath environments
  • Reduces physical size and component count in mobile terminals and IoT tags
